Kitchen v. Rosenfeld
Kitchen v. Rosenfeld
1 R.I. Dec. 134
Opinion of the Court
Defendant has petitioned for a new trial on the ground that the damages are excessive.
The plaintiff was allowed to testify without objection that the furniture in question was worth $195. The value of the individual items was not brought out on cross-examination. The jury returned a verdict for the plaintiff in the sum of $110 and interest, making a total of $135.70. The Court is not satisfied that the amount is excessive.
Defendant’s petition for a new trial is denied.
